Covid-19: Nigeria Records 260 New Cases, Total Now 12,486

Published

on

The Nigeria Centre for Disease Control on Sunday, June 7, 2020, announced there are 260 new Covid-19 cases in Nigeria.

The total number of confirmed cases of coronavirus in the country has risen to 12,486 and the cases were recorded in 18 states and the Federal Capital Territory, Abuja

Abia state takes the lead amidst new cases with 67, followed by Abuja with 40, while Lagos, the epicentre of the pandemic in Nigeria has 38 cases.

In its Sunday updates, the NCDC stated that 19 new cases were detected in Ogun, 16 in Edo, 14 vs Imo, nine in Kwara and eight each in Katsina, Nassarawa and Borno.

Six cases were also recorded in Kaduna, five in Bauchi, four in Ekiti, two each in Niger, Plateau, Kano and Sokoto.

In addition, the number of discharge cases rose to 3959 as 133 more patients recovered from the virus, while 12 more coronavirus-deaths were also recorded. The total number of coronavirus fatalities in the country now stand at 354.
